nRF9151 Connect Kit Unable to Register on Network Using iBasis SIM

I recently purchased the Maker Diary nRF9151 Connect Kit (LTE-M/NB-IoT, nRF9151 SiP) and I am using the iBasis SIM that came with the Nordic Thingy:91. The device is unable to register on any LTE-M/NB-IoT network using this SIM.

I tested the device in two different locations with the same result:

  • New Avenue, Gilroy (California)

  • Mission Boulevard, Santa Clara (California)

In both places there was no network registration. Signal strength is always shown as +CSQ: 99,99, PDP context does not activate, and %XMONITOR remains stuck in searching.

Do I need any special activation steps for the iBasis SIM? Is the SIM compatible with the nRF9151 Connect Kit? Are there carrier/region restrictions in the locations above? Is any additional configuration required compared to the Thingy:91?

AT commands used:

AT+CFUN=0 AT%XSYSTEMMODE=1,1,0,0 AT+CGDCONT=1,"IP","ibasis.iot" AT+CFUN=1


Observed:

+CSQ: 99,99
%XMONITOR: 2 (searching)

AT+COPS=?
+COPS: (1,"","","313100",7), (1,"","","310410",7), (1,"","","311480",9), (1,"","","310260",7), (1,"","","310260",9), (1,"","","311480",7)
AT+COPS?
+COPS: 1

The device is able to scan available PLMNs, but attach never completes. Kindly advise how to enable successful LTE-M/NB-IoT registration using the iBasis SIM on the nRF9151 Connect Kit.

  • AT+CSQ
    However, the signal strength still reads 99,99, and it’s unclear?

    Good point to start reading the documentation (nrf91x1_cellular_at_commands_v1.3.pdf, page 30), that will bring the missing clarity.

    %XMONITOR: 5,"AT&T","AT&T","310410","AF06",7,12,"0A1FFD11",66,5110,37,21,"","11100000","11100000","01001001" OK

    Here the 37 and 21 are the values, which according nrf91x1_cellular_at_commands_v1.3.pdf, page 159/160 results in:

    rsrp: -104 dBm

    snr: -4 dB
